Originally Posted by Autotooner
sweet ride!! what all have you done to it?


Thank you, sir. Hmmmm....lets see, It's quite a list but here we go. We will start with the engine bay first.

Stock bore 302 w/ block and pan painted to match the color scheme of the car.

forged pistons/rods/crank

Twisted wedge 185cc heads

TFS cam 499 lift/221 duration

Trick Flow Track Heat intake re-powdercoated to match the wheels and lower half's color


75mm TB

75MM MAF

42lb injectors

255lph Walbro intank fuel pump

Polished S-trim supercharger @ 10psi

UPR Boost Master intake tube (not installed on the pics)

MAC equal length headers connected to MAC off road H-Pipe connected to Flowmasters of course lol.

Built AOD with 2800 stall converter

Suspension:

Tokico Illuminas on all four corners (5-way adjustable)

FRPP B springs

5-lug conversion

MRT Adjustable LCA'S

31 spline axles and differential

18x9 FR500 w/ 275/35 BFG KDW Drag Radials in the back and 245/35 BFG G-Force KDW-NT's in the front


I think that's it lol
